Holyfield denies steroids link
“I do not use steroids. I have never used steroids,” said the 44-year-old US fighter who is in the midst of a comeback bid to claim the heavyweight throne for a fifth time.
“I resent that my name has been linked to known steroid users by sources who refuse to be identified in order to generate publicity for their investigation.”
Federal agents raided pharmacies in Florida and Alabama, with authorities telling the Times-Union newspaper of Albany, New York, that Holyfield used the name “Evan Fields” when placing orders from a Mobile, Alabama, pharmacy.
Major League Baseball and NFL players were also named on the customer list following Tuesday’s seizures of records and computers.
Asked about reports he purchased performance-enhancing drugs, Holyfield replied, “Enhance me to do what?”
Holyfield, who will turn 45 in October, has fought twice in Texas in his comeback bid, with another fight set for March 17 against fellow American Vinny Maddalone.
